## Summary

On the stierproducts yoga mats board, Manduka Pro Mat ranks #1 in S tier, ahead of JadeYoga Harmony Mat (#2, A tier) and Lululemon The Mat 5 mm (#3, A tier). The board ranks 10 yoga mats from S (best) to F (avoid), last researched 7 Aug 2026, drawing on 53 outlet citations across the board. Placed in the bottom tiers as ones to avoid: Gaiam Essentials Yoga Mat, Manduka Pro Light and Jade Travel Mat.

## How to read this

- Each category is researched in four independent runs, one per lens (expert consensus, value, reliability, community pulse). Every run ranks a board of candidates that deliberately includes products buyers cross-shop but should avoid. Placements score on a ranked ladder (LP), and tiers are derived from LP, so no tier is ever assigned by hand.
- LP is the product's points on this category's ladder. It is comparable within a category and not across categories.
- Outlets is how many distinct outlets are cited for that placement. The per-product page lists each citation, and shows which of their links were fetched and confirmed before publishing.
- Nothing is hidden: every product the research placed is on this board.
